Saint Kitts and Nevis Flag Flag Information divided diagonally from the lower hoist side by a broad black band bearing two white, five-pointed stars the black band is edged in yellow the upper triangle is green, the lower triangle is red green signifies the island's fertility, red symbolizes the struggles of the people from slavery, yellow denotes year-round sunshine, and black represents the African heritage of the people the white stars stand for the islands of Saint Kitts and Nevis, but can also express hope and liberty, or independence and optimism
